Atlético Man Joins Garitano at Sporting
Asier Garitano, the new coach of Sporting de Gijón, has added Pedro Hernández, a professional with a past at Atlético de Madrid, to his coaching staff. Hernández, who until now was the assistant coach at CUC Villalba, Atlético’s second reserve team, joins the Asturian team to contribute his experience and knowledge.
His professional career has been linked to Garitano since their beginnings at Castellón, where they coincided. Later, Hernández was part of Zinedine Zidane’s technical team at Real Madrid, performing scouting and rival analysis tasks.
Garitano already relied on him during his spells at Leganés and Tenerife, which demonstrates the confidence he places in his work. Alongside Queco Piña and Miguel Pérez, Hernández completes the team that will help Garitano reverse the current situation of Sporting and take them to the top.
